ACT Research: Class Preliminary 8 Net Orders Strong in a Historically Weak Month
COLUMBUS, IN – Demand for commercial vehicles remained at healthy levels in July as 45,400 total NA Classes 5-8 orders were booked. In the ten months since the start of stronger orders last October, NA Classes 5-8 net orders have been booked at an average of 45,200 units per month. Annualized, that represents a total […]
ACT Research: HD and MD Orders Continue Strong in July: 2014 Shaping Up to be Best of Cycle
COLUMBUS, IN – For the second month in a row, Class 8 orders surprised on the high side in July, with net orders of 30,103. Classes 5-7 net orders also posted a gain in July, coming in at 15,834 units. These results were published in the latest State of the Industry report, recently released by […]

ACT Research: Trailer Net Orders Up 45% for First Half of 2014
Trailer Net Orders Up 45% for First Half of 2014 COLUMBUS, IN – June net orders of 22,000 were off 1% month over month, but up 42% year over year. Year-to-date net orders of 156k are up 45% over the same period last year. This information was included in the most recent State of the […]
